Coze 和 n8n 的详细介绍及多维度对比分析,涵盖功能、架构、适用场景、成本等关键指标
以下是 Coze 和 n8n 的详细介绍及多维度对比分析,涵盖功能、架构、适用场景、成本等关键指标:

一、Coze 详细介绍
1. 基础信息
- 类型:低代码自动化平台(SaaS)。
- 开源性:闭源(企业版需付费)。
- 部署方式:仅提供云服务(SaaS)。
- 适用场景:个人、小型团队的轻量级自动化需求(如数据同步、表单自动化、流程简化)。
- 核心定位:快速搭建简单工作流,无需代码。
2. 核心功能
- 可视化拖拽:通过图形化界面快速连接应用和定义流程。
- 连接器生态:支持主流应用(如Slack、Google Sheets、Notion、Zapier等)。
- 基础脚本支持:部分节点支持简单脚本(如JavaScript片段)。
- 自动化模板:提供预设模板(如“收到邮件时自动创建任务”)。
- 日程调度:支持定时任务(如每天运行)。
- 权限管理:基础团队协作功能(如共享工作流)。
3. 架构与扩展性
- 架构:基于云服务的集中式架构,无需本地部署。
- 扩展性:依赖内置连接器和模板,自定义能力有限。
- API集成:支持通过API触发工作流,但需手动配置。
4. 安全与合规
- 数据安全:提供加密传输和数据隔离。
- 合规性:符合基础安全标准(如GDPR),但透明度较低(闭源)。
5. 成本
- 定价:按需付费(免费版功能有限,付费版按用户/工作流计费)。
- 免费层限制:基础连接器、少量工作流、存储限制。
典型用户
- 个人用户、小型团队、初创公司。
二、n8n 详细介绍
1. 基础信息
- 类型:开源低代码自动化平台(支持企业级扩展)。
- 开源性:社区版开源(Apache 2.0),企业版(n8n.io)闭源。
- 部署方式:本地部署(Docker/Kubernetes)、云服务(n8n.io)、自托管。
- 适用场景:个人、中小型企业、复杂自动化需求(如跨系统集成、数据处理)。
- 核心定位:灵活、可定制的自动化平台,支持复杂工作流。
2. 核心功能
- 可视化拖拽:高度灵活的节点拖拽,支持条件分支、循环、并行执行。
- 连接器生态:超过400+官方和社区贡献的连接器(如Salesforce、Airtable、AWS、Slack等)。
- 代码支持:支持JavaScript/Python脚本节点,自定义逻辑。
- 高级功能:
- 条件分支:基于变量动态路由。
- 循环处理:遍历数组或对象批量操作。
- 并行执行:多节点同时运行。
- 错误处理:自定义重试策略和错误通知。
- 模板库:丰富的预设工作流模板(如“订单同步到ERP”)。
- API集成:通过Webhook或REST API触发/调用工作流。
3. 架构与扩展性
- 架构:模块化设计,支持本地部署和云服务。
- 扩展性:
- 自定义连接器:通过Node.js或Python开发新连接器。
- 插件系统:支持第三方插件扩展功能。
- 集群部署:通过Kubernetes实现高可用和弹性扩展。
- API与SDK:提供REST API和SDK,支持自动化管理。
4. 安全与合规
- 数据安全:支持加密、RBAC权限管理、审计日志。
- 合规性:通过ISO 27001认证,支持GDPR、HIPAA等合规要求(企业版)。
5. 成本
- 社区版:免费(自托管,需自行维护)。
- 企业版(n8n.io):按用户/工作流付费,支持私有云部署。
- 免费层限制:社区版无功能限制,但需自行部署和维护。
典型用户
- 中小型企业、开发者、需要复杂自动化的企业(如电商、SaaS公司)。
三、Coze vs n8n 多维度对比
1. 核心功能对比
| 维度 | Coze | n8n |
|---|---|---|
| 可视化拖拽 | 支持基础流程设计 | 支持复杂分支、循环、并行 |
| 代码支持 | 有限(部分节点支持脚本) | 支持JavaScript/Python脚本 |
| 连接器数量 | 约50+(依赖官方支持) | 超400+(官方+社区) |
| 条件分支 | 基础条件判断 | 复杂条件分支(如动态路由、循环) |
| 错误处理 | 基础重试机制 | 自定义错误处理流程 |
| 模板库 | 提供预设模板 | 丰富的社区贡献模板 |
| API集成 | 基础API触发 | 强大的API集成能力(REST/Webhook) |
2. 部署与扩展性
| 维度 | Coze | n8n |
|---|---|---|
| 部署方式 | 仅SaaS | 本地部署、云服务、Kubernetes |
| 扩展性 | 依赖内置功能,自定义能力有限 | 高度可扩展(自定义连接器、插件) |
| 集群支持 | 无 | 支持Kubernetes集群部署 |
| 开发成本 | 无开发需求(纯低代码) | 需基础开发能力(自定义脚本/连接器) |
3. 安全与合规
| 维度 | Coze | n8n |
|---|---|---|
| 数据安全 | 基础加密,透明度低(闭源) | 支持加密、RBAC、审计日志(企业版) |
| 合规性 | 符合基础标准,但透明度不足 | 通过ISO 27001认证,支持GDPR等合规 |
4. 成本与适用场景
| 维度 | Coze | n8n |
|---|---|---|
| 成本模型 | SaaS按需付费(免费层有限) | 社区版免费,企业版按需付费 |
| 适用场景 | 个人/小型团队轻量级需求 | 个人/企业复杂需求(如跨系统集成) |
| 最佳用户 | 非技术用户、快速搭建简单流程 | 开发者、需要高度定制的企业 |
四、总结对比表
| 维度 | Coze | n8n |
|---|---|---|
| 核心优势 | 零代码快速搭建、开箱即用 | 高度灵活、开源生态、复杂工作流支持 |
| 适用场景 | 简单流程自动化(如表单同步) | 复杂跨系统集成、企业级自动化 |
| 学习曲线 | 低(纯拖拽界面) | 中(需了解脚本和配置) |
| 扩展性 | 有限 | 非常高(开源+插件) |
| 部署复杂度 | 低(SaaS) | 中(需自托管或云服务) |
| 典型用户 | 个人、小型团队 | 开发者、中大型企业 |
五、选择建议
-
选择Coze的场景:
- 需要快速搭建简单流程(如表单自动化、数据同步)。
- 预算有限,偏好SaaS服务,无需自建服务器。
- 团队技术能力有限,追求“零代码”体验。
-
选择n8n的场景:
- 需要复杂自动化(如跨系统数据处理、循环操作)。
- 需要自定义脚本或连接器。
- 企业级需求(高安全、合规、扩展性)。
- 偏好开源生态和灵活性。
六、示例场景
场景1:电商订单同步
- Coze:通过预设模板快速将Shopify订单同步到Google Sheets。
- n8n:自定义脚本过滤订单数据,批量处理并同步到ERP系统,支持错误重试和日志记录。
场景2:数据分析自动化
- Coze:定时从Notion导出数据到Excel。
- n8n:从多个数据源(如Salesforce、Google Analytics)提取数据,通过Python脚本清洗后存入Snowflake。
如需具体配置示例或迁移方案,可进一步提供需求细节。
相关文章:
Coze 和 n8n 的详细介绍及多维度对比分析,涵盖功能、架构、适用场景、成本等关键指标
以下是 Coze 和 n8n 的详细介绍及多维度对比分析,涵盖功能、架构、适用场景、成本等关键指标: 一、Coze 详细介绍 1. 基础信息 类型:低代码自动化平台(SaaS)。开源性:闭源(企业版需付费&…...
咋用fliki的AI生成各类视频?AI生成视频教程
最近想制作视频,多方考查了决定用fliki,于是订阅了一年试试,这个AI生成的视频效果来看真是不错,感兴趣的自己官网注册个账号体验一下就知道了。 fliki官网 Fliki生成视频教程 创建账户并登录 首先,访问fliki官网并注…...
【NLP】 20. Attention 和 self-attention
1. 背景与基本概念 1.1 编码器-解码器模型的瓶颈问题 传统的序列到序列(Seq2Seq)模型主要依靠编码器生成单一固定长度的上下文向量,然后由解码器逐步生成输出。这个过程存在两个主要问题: 瓶颈问题:固定…...
vue3+element-plus实现省市区三级地址多选
目录 背景实现功能点遗留问题完整代码参考 背景 需要实现:选择省级地址时,回传节点为 [ 省级地址 id], 选择市级地址时,回传节点为 [ 省级地址 id,市级地址 id], 选择区县地址时,回传节点为 [ …...
centos部署的openstack发布windows虚拟机
CentOS上部署的OpenStack可以发布Windows虚拟机。在CentOS上部署OpenStack后,可以通过OpenStack平台创建和管理Windows虚拟机。以下是具体的步骤和注意事项: 安装和配置OpenStack: 首先,确保系统满足OpenStack的最低硬件…...
Linux : 进程等待以及进程终止
进程控制之进程等待 (一)fork函数1*fork函数返回值2.父子进程的写时拷贝 (二)进程终止1.进程退出码2.进程常见退出方法(1)_exit(2)exit(3)return 3.进程的异常…...
LSTM结合LightGBM高纬时序预测
1. LSTM 时间序列预测 LSTM 是 RNN(Recurrent Neural Network)的一种变体,它解决了普通 RNN 训练时的梯度消失和梯度爆炸问题,适用于长期依赖的时间序列建模。 LSTM 结构 LSTM 由 输入门(Input Gate)、遗…...
详细解释MCP项目中安装命令 bunx 和 npx区别
详细解释 bunx 和 npx 1. bunx bunx 是 Bun 的一个命令行工具,用于自动安装和运行来自 npm 的包。它是 Bun 生态系统中类似于 npx 或 yarn dlx 的工具。以下是 bunx 的主要特点和使用方法: 自动安装和运行: bunx 会自动从 npm 安装所需的包…...
【统信UOS操作系统】python3.11安装numpy库及导入问题解决
一、安装Python3.11.4 首先来安装Python3.11.4。所用操作系统:统信UOS 前提是准备好Python3.11.4的安装包(可从官网下载(链接)),并解压到本地: 右键,选择“在终端中打开”ÿ…...
【中间件】nginx反向代理实操
一、说明 nginx用于做反向代理,其目标是将浏览器中的请求进行转发,应用场景如下: 说明: 1、用户在浏览器中发送请求 2、nginx监听到浏览器中的请求时,将该请求转发到网关 3、网关再将请求转发至对应服务 二、具体操作…...
嵌入式硬件篇---加法减法积分微分器
文章目录 前言1. 加法器(Summing Amplifier)结构反相加法器同相加法器 特点反相输出虚地特性 应用 2. 减法器(差分放大器)结构特点差分放大共模抑制比 应用 3. 积分器结构特点直流漂移问题应用 4. 微分器结构特点应用关键注意事项…...
Spring Cloud Gateway 的执行链路详解
Spring Cloud Gateway 的执行链路详解 🎯 核心目标 明确 Spring Cloud Gateway 的请求处理全过程(从接收到请求 → 到转发 → 到返回响应),方便你在合适的生命周期节点插入你的逻辑。 🧱 核心执行链路图(执…...
鸿蒙应用(医院诊疗系统)开发篇2·Axios网络请求封装全流程解析
一、项目初始化与环境准备 1. 创建鸿蒙工程 src/main/ets/ ├── api/ │ ├── api.ets # 接口聚合入口 │ ├── login.ets # 登录模块接口 │ └── request.ets # 网络请求核心封装 └── pages/ └── login.ets # 登录页面逻辑…...
突发重磅消息!!!CVE项目将被取消?
突发重磅消息!!!CVE项目将被取消?突发!来自可靠消息来源。MITRE 对 CVE 项目的支持将于明天到期。附件信件已发送给 CVE 董事会成员。https://mp.weixin.qq.com/s/N3qkiHaDfzDuBMK3JbBCjw...
详解与FTP服务器相关操作
目录 什么是FTP服务器 搭建FTP服务器相关 编辑 Unity中与FTP相关的类 上传文件到FTP服务器 使用FTP服务器上传文件的关键点 开始上传 从FTP服务器下载文件到客户端 使用FTP下载文件的关键点 开始下载 关于FTP服务器的其他操作 将文件的上传,下载&…...
远程登录一个Linux系统,如何用命令快速知道该系统属于Linux的哪个发行版,以及该服务器的各种配置参数,运行状态?
远程登录一个Linux系统,如何用命令快速知道该系统属于Linux的哪个发行版,以及该服务器的各种配置参数,运行状态? 查看Linux发行版信息 查看发行版名称和版本: cat /etc/*-release或 lsb_release -a查看内核版本&#…...
解决 .Net 6.0 项目发布到IIS报错:HTTP Error 500.30
今天在将自己开发许久的项目上线的时候,发现 IIS 发布后请求后端老是报一个 HTTP Error 500.30 的异常,如下图所示。 后来仔细调查了一下发现是自己的程序中写了 UseStaticFiles 的依赖注入,这个的主要作用就是发布后端后,想…...
STM32F103_HAL库+寄存器学习笔记16 - 监控CAN发送失败(轮询方式)
导言 《STM32F103_HAL库寄存器学习笔记15 - 梳理CAN发送失败时,涉及哪些寄存器》从上一章节看到,当CAN消息发送失败时,CAN错误状态寄存器ESR的TEC会持续累加,LEC等于0x03(ACK错误)。本次实验的目的是编写一…...
Java并发-AQS框架原理解析与实现类详解
什么是AQS? AQS(AbstractQueuedSynchronizer)是Java并发包(JUC)的核心基础框架,它为构建锁和同步器提供了高效、灵活的底层支持。本文将从设计原理、核心机制及典型实现类三个维度展开,帮助读者…...
实现定长的内存池
池化技术 所谓的池化技术,就是程序预先向系统申请过量的资源,然后自己管理起来,以备不时之需。这个操作的价值就是,如果申请与释放资源的开销较大,提前申请资源并在使用后并不释放而是重复利用,能够提高程序…...
vs2022使用git方法
1、创建git 2、在cmd下执行 git push -f origin master ,会把本地代码全部推送到远程,同时会覆盖远程代码。 3、需要设置【Git全局设置】,修改的代码才会显示可以提交,否则是灰色的不能提交。 4、创建的分支,只要点击…...
Mysql中表的使用(3)
目录 1.updata的使用 2.delete(删除表中数据)drop(删除表) 数据库的约束 1.NOT NULL 指定列不能为空 2.UNIQUE指定列唯一 3.DEFAULT(默认值) 4.PRIMARY KEY 5.自增主键 1.updata的使用 1.0update 表名 set 列名x where 列名y; 2.0update 表名 s…...
BUUCTF-Web(1-20)
目录 一.SQL注入 (1)[极客大挑战 2019]EasySQL 万能密码 (7)[SUCTF 2019]EasySQL 堆叠注入 解一: 解二: (10)[强网杯 2019]随便注 堆叠注入 解一: 解二: 解三: (8)[极客大挑战 2019]LoveSQL 联…...
Uniapp:确认框
目录 一、 出现场景二、 效果展示三、具体使用 一、 出现场景 在项目的开发中,会经常出现删除数据的情况,如果直接删除的话,可能会存在误删,用户体验不好,所以需要增加一个消息提示,提醒用户是否删除。 二…...
【前端网络请求入门】XMLHttpRequest与Fetch保姆级教程
新手学前端时,经常会被「如何让网页和服务器说话」难住。今天我们用最通俗的语言,把浏览器最常用的两种网络请求方式——XMLHttpRequest和Fetch讲清楚,还会带完整的代码示例,跟着敲一遍就能上手! 一、先搞懂「网络请求…...
力扣热题100—滑动窗口(c++)
3.无重复字符的最长子串 给定一个字符串 s ,请你找出其中不含有重复字符的 最长 子串 的长度。 unordered_set<char> charSet; // 用于保存当前窗口的字符int left 0; // 窗口左指针int maxLength 0; // 最长子串的长度for (int right 0; right < s.siz…...
实验四 中断实验
一、实验目的 掌握中断服务程序的编写。 二、实验电路 三、实验内容 1.实验用PC机内部的中断控制器8259A,中断源用TPC-ZK实验箱上的单脉冲电路,将单脉冲电路的输出接中断请求信号IRQ,每按一次单脉冲按键产生一次…...
腾势品牌欧洲市场冲锋,科技豪华席卷米兰
在时尚与艺术的交汇点,米兰设计周的舞台上,一场汽车界的超级风暴正在酝酿,腾势品牌如一头勇猛无畏的雄狮,以雷霆万钧之势正式向欧洲市场发起了冲锋。其最新力作——腾势Z9GT的登场,仿佛是一道闪电划破夜空,…...
第五阶段:项目实践与后续学习指引
模块 10:综合项目实践 在这个模块中,我们将通过实际项目来综合运用前面所学的 Python 知识。我们会选择一个命令行记事本应用作为主要示例,同时简要介绍其他项目的思路。 项目:命令行记事本应用 1. 项目规划 良好的项目规划是…...
MoogDB数据库日常维护技巧与常见问题解析
在当今的数据驱动世界中,数据库作为信息存储与管理的核心组件,扮演着举足轻重的角色。MoogDB作为一款高性能、易扩展的数据库解决方案,越来越受到开发者和企业的青睐。为了确保MoogDB的稳定性与高性能,定期的日常维护及对常见问题…...
